Is it a hissing sound like the sound a cai makes? Its also not uncommon for headers to increase engine noise such as the slight hiss of airflow or the infamous honda 'tick'.
Have a sniff arround the engine and see if you can detect any slight exhaust odor.
Or clean your enginebay, then check the engine bay a few days later and see if there is any carbon buildup arround the piping which can suggest a leak.
